The long effort by the late John Lennon to become a legal resident of the United States will be the subject of a documentary by David Leaf, John Scheinfeld and Steve Ligerman for Lions Gate Films.
Lennon’s widow, Yoko Ono, has agreed to cooperate on “The U.S. vs. John Lennon,” which the company plans to release next year, 30 years after Lennon was granted the right to live in the U.S.
